TomTom iPhone App: Available in New Zealand’s AppStore

murdaFSM

Waiting for the iPhone version of TomTom has an end. The navigation package is now available in four variants in New Zealand’s App Store: Western Europe (85 euros / $121), USA & Canada (60 euros / $100), New Zealand (60 euros / $100 ) and Australia (50 euros / $70).
